Nokia Succumbs to Smartphone Anorexia With the 6300

By far the biggest examples of smartphone anorexia, or mobiles that feature really thin form factors, come from Motorola and Samsung. Motorola brought itself back into the game with the RAZR, while Samsung claimed the thinnest-of-them-all trophy with its Ultra Edition.

With the Nokia 6300, it looks like the Finns are jumping on the bandwagon. Though relatively fat at 11.7mm thick (43.6 wide and 106.4 long), the 6300 is still thin enough not to bulge pockets. There are also some multimedia features liberally integrated, but the lack of 3G may turn off connectivity freaks. The SPEC summary:

  • Tri-band GSM (900/1800/1900 Mhz) smartphone
  • Color QVGA display
  • 7.8MB internal memory, microSD slot accepts up to 1GB
  • 2 megapixel camera
  • FM radio
  • Music player
  • Comes in silver and black
